Output 6545c91dc6a69a823f0d654758a1b29de22ce605e86a24e5301dc0dfd57a9899:2

value
18193349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22403e72f41ef8412915873dc545ef04a29f07cc OP_EQUAL
address
34p7rp8CcrVW7rAftbuHex2QpLYtz6keA6
transaction
6545c91dc6a69a823f0d654758a1b29de22ce605e86a24e5301dc0dfd57a9899
spent
true